Title information

Global Environment Outlook - 3


Series: GLOBAL ENVIRONMENT OUTLOOK (GEO) SERIES 3
UNEP
446 pages, col photos, illus, figs, tabs, maps.
Earthscan
 
Softcover and CD set | 2002 | £34.95 | approx. $70/€45

#127113 | ISBN-10: 1853838454
Hardcover and CD set | 2002 | £85.00 | approx. $168/€109

#127114 | ISBN-10: 1853838446
Continuing the global and regional focus of previous outlooks, Global Environment Outlook - 3 examines the environmental trends of the past 30 years to provide an integrated explanation of the developments that have occurred. It not only examines the state of the environment over that period, but also the full range of social, economic, political and cultural drivers that have brought about change. Highlighting human vulnerability to environmental deterioration, it assesses the effects of the spectrum of policy measures adopted. Finally, GEO - 3 develops a range of scenarios for the next 30 years with detailed exploration of the policies and instruments available at different levels for improving environmental conditions.
It is clearly organised in accessible, non-technical language, and supported by colour graphs and quick 'highlights'. With full bibliography and index it will be essential for researchers, teachers, students, and policy-makers in environmental science and policy, geography, politics and international affairs.
The contents of GEO - 3 are based on information supplied by a global network of collaborating centres, and numerous individual experts and specialized institutions from around the world, giving it unrivalled accuracy and authority. The reports sets an action-oriented environmental agenda for the World Summit on Sustainable Development in Johannesburg and beyond.
The CD-ROM contains the full text of the report accompanied by a compendium of the data used in preparing it.
